Freetobook - accommodation in Elgin
More than just hotels
Apartments, cabins, holiday rentals and more, plus millions of reviews from Aussie & Kiwi travellers
Flexibility matters
24/7 support, so you can book with confidence
Unlock member prices with Mates Rates
You could save 10% or more on over 100,000 hotels right now.
Check hotel availability in Elgin
Featured Elgin Freetobook accommodation

Ben Mhor Hotel
53-57 High St, Grantown-on-Spey, Scotland
The price is AU$71 per night
AU$71
includes taxes & fees
24 Feb - 25 Feb
Ben Mhor Hotel: Pet-friendly hotel with free WiFi and free parking. Located near skiing.
Pet-friendly
Parking included
Free cancellation
Reserve now, pay when you stay

Cawdor House
7 Cawdor Street, Nairn, Scotland
Cawdor House: Pet-friendly bed & breakfast with free breakfast and free WiFi. Located in the historical district.
Breakfast included
Pet-friendly

Cardhu Country House
Knockando, Aberlour, Scotland
The price is AU$277 per night
AU$277
includes taxes & fees
25 Mar - 26 Mar
Cardhu Country House: Guest house with free breakfast and free WiFi.
Breakfast included
Parking included
Free cancellation
Reserve now, pay when you stay

The Bandstand
Crescent Road, Nairn, Scotland
The price is AU$209 per night
AU$209
includes taxes & fees
27 Feb - 28 Feb
The Bandstand: Hotel with free breakfast and free WiFi.
Breakfast included
Free WiFi
Free cancellation
Reserve now, pay when you stay

Havelock Hotel
Crescent Road, Nairn, Scotland
The price is AU$133 per night
AU$133
includes taxes & fees
26 Feb - 27 Feb
Havelock Hotel: Eco-certified inn with free WiFi and free parking. Located near a train station.
Parking included
Free WiFi
Free cancellation
Reserve now, pay when you stay

Gordon Arms Hotel
The Square, Huntly, Scotland
Gordon Arms Hotel: Pet-friendly hotel with free breakfast and free WiFi.
Breakfast included
Pet-friendly

Strathallan Bed and Breakfast
Strathallan House Grant Road, Grantown-on-Spey, Scotland
Strathallan Bed and Breakfast: Guest house with free breakfast and free WiFi.
Breakfast included
Parking included

Tarrel Farmhouse
Tarrel House, Portmahomack, Tain, Scotland
The price is AU$308 per night
AU$308
includes taxes & fees
25 Mar - 26 Mar
Tarrel Farmhouse: Bed & breakfast with free breakfast and free WiFi.
Breakfast included
Parking included

6 Varis Apartments
8 Varis Wynd, High Street, Moray, Forres, Scotland
6 Varis Apartments: Pet-friendly apartments with free WiFi and free parking.
Kitchen
Washer

Invernairne Guest House
Thurlow Road, Nairn, Scotland
The price is AU$174 per night
AU$174
includes taxes & fees
28 Feb - 1 Mar
Invernairne Guest House: Golf guesthouse with free WiFi and a bar/lounge. Located on the beach.
Free WiFi
Bar
Free cancellation
Reserve now, pay when you stay
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Freetobook Accommodation in Elgin
Search for hotels in Elgin on Wotif. You can easily find your hotels in Elgin using one of the methods below:
- View our selection of featured hotels in Elgin
- Use the map to find hotels in the Elgin neighbourhood you prefer
- Use the filters to see hotels in a specific area of Elgin, select a specific theme, brand, or hotel class from basic to luxury hotels in Elgin
- Enter your travel dates to view the best deals on hotels in Elgin - while they last
New reviews! Best hotels in Elgin

Elgin Stopover
5 / 5
Good hotel close to station. Easy walk into town. Food good and reasonably priced. Rooms comfortable.
A verified traveller stayed at Laichmoray Hotel
Posted 2 weeks ago
Nearby cities
Near an airport
Near an Attraction
Hotel themes
More accommodations
Hotel brands
More destinations for you
Hotels
Dundee AccommodationPet Friendly Hotels in AyrStromness AccommodationPitlochry AccommodationLerwick AccommodationOban AccommodationGlasgow AccommodationWick AccommodationBallater AccommodationStirling AccommodationPortree AccommodationPlockton AccommodationHawick AccommodationBrae AccommodationUllapool AccommodationInverness AccommodationAberdeen AccommodationHotels with Parking in GlasgowMallaig AccommodationThurso AccommodationFort William Accommodation
Activities
Packages
Holiday Rentals
^Eligibility requirements and conditions apply.